Solution Overview
Problem
Current computing and communication devices do not allow users to download, purchase, or capture content being broadcast from a broadcast station and receive it on audio/video devices such as stereos or televisions.
Innovation Solution
A server device communicates with user devices to receive requests for content, matches identifiers to user and station profiles, and sends notifications for authorized access, enabling users to capture and access broadcast content through a network.

Data Source
AI summary
A server device that communicates with a user device and the server device is enabled to receive a request for a copy of content, the request including a first identifier associated with the content, information associated with the user device, and information associated with a broadcast station that is broadcasting the content. The server device may obtain a user profile associated with the user device and obtain a station profile associated with a broadcast station, and identify the content, in the station profile. The server device may obtain the copy of the content to enable the user device to access the copy of the content and send, to the user profile, a notification indicating that the user device is authorized to access to the content.
